I just finished adding a air compressor to the pushback truck I designed and built.
It was built to pull my models to the flight line from my tralier. I use to pull them with a strap.
But, I am wanting to bend down less and less as I get older.
As it turns out the pushback truck has been a real hit at our field and the guys
really enjoy seeing it in action. In fact i have no problem getting a driver for it.
I am sure the on-board air compressor will put it over the top when they find out about it.

Bob is here next to me states the engines are Chinese engines, he bought them 3 yrs ago they are 600kv equivalent to an eflight 46, 38amps full power per motor, using 4 lipos 5K 4S per motor, 70amp speed controllers, blades are master screw 11x7 plastic 3 bladed
